Products form a system

Cross-section: from substrate to impregnation

A

Substrate

Existing concrete, screed, or masonry

B

Primer

Bonding bridge and evening out of absorbency

C

Levelling

Repairing unevenness and preparing a level surface

D

Final layer

Exposed concrete look: skim coat or self-levelling compound

E

Impregnation

Surface protection: reduced abrasion and absorption

01

Coatings, skim coats, and reprofiling

Materials designed to protect, repair, and restore concrete and building structures. The range includes final coatings, fine skim coats, reprofiling mortars, and special repair compounds for both new and existing structures.

6 products · Final layer: walls and ceilings

Group: Concrete skim coats and design renders

A final concrete skim coat in the colour of cured concrete for interior and exterior walls and ceilings, designed for application at a thickness of 0.3 to 3 mm.

BETOFIN B is a fine powder polymer-cement mix based on Portland cement, sand up to 0.09 mm, and special fillers, modified with chemical admixtures to achieve optimal workability and hardened-material properties. The applied compound cures over approximately 28 days, at which point its maximum strength is guaranteed.

REPAFIN 5 is intended for levelling uneven substrates before application.

Layer thickness

0.3–3 mm

Grain size

up to 0.09 mm

Curing

28 days

Group: Concrete skim coats and design renders · variant of BETOFIN B

A variant of the BETOFIN B skim coat with accelerated setting and hardening. After approximately 40–60 minutes, the product begins to thicken on the wall.

At this point, the surface can be worked by hand with an individual trowelling technique to create an interesting layered visual texture.

Layer thickness

0.3–3 mm

Setting onset

40–60 min

Curing

28 days

Group: Concrete skim coats and design renders

A final and base one-component microcement concrete skim coat for interior and exterior floors, walls, and ceilings, applied at a thickness of 0.2 to 3 mm.

A fine powder cement mix based on an organic polymer, Portland cement, and fine sand from 0.09 to 0.5 mm. Its exceptional visual effect is paired with low abrasion, high hardness, low water absorption, and easy surface cleaning.

The standard colour shade is white; custom tinting is available on request. The high polymer content ensures extreme bond strength to the substrate and a long service life.

Layer thickness

0.2–3 mm

Grain size

0.09–0.5 mm

Shades

white + custom tinting

Group: Concrete skim coats and design renders

A concrete skim coat in the colour of cured concrete for interior and exterior walls and ceilings. Applied at a thickness of 1–5 mm over the full surface, and locally on smaller areas up to 1 m² at up to 10 mm.

A powder polymer-cement mix based on Portland cement and sand up to 0.3 mm. Its strength is comparable to C20/25 class concrete.

Serves as a base layer before applying the final BETOFIN B and BR skim coats.

Layer thickness

1–5 mm (locally 10 mm)

Strength class

~ C 20/25

Curing

28 days

Group: Concrete skim coats and design renders · variant of REPAFIN 5

A variant of the REPAFIN 5 skim coat with accelerated setting and hardening. After approximately 40–60 minutes, the compound begins to thicken and harden; the layer fully hardens within 2–5 hours depending on climatic conditions.

Applying the primer and the final BETOFIN B skim coat is recommended once the base layer has dried.

Layer thickness

1–5 mm (locally 10 mm)

Setting onset

40–60 min

Layer hardening

2–5 h

Group: Self-levelling and auxiliary compounds, screeds

A fine cement filling and bonding compound for repairing uneven areas and holes in substrates, for example before levelling with self-levelling floor compounds indoors.

A powder polymer-cement mix based on Portland cement and sand up to 0.5 mm. The compound has high initial strength: it becomes walkable approximately 40 minutes after mixing, with a working time of approximately 10 minutes.

REPAMALT 40 can also be used for bonding tiles using standard methods.

Compressive strength (28 d)

> 18 MPa

Foot traffic

~ 40 min

Working time

~ 10 min

02

Levelling compounds and screeds

Self-levelling and flooring systems designed to prepare substrates before laying final flooring layers. The products ensure high flatness, strength, and reliable processing in both new builds and renovations.

3 products · Final layer: floors

Group: Self-levelling and auxiliary compounds, screeds

A powder universal high-strength, fast-setting and fast-hardening self-levelling compound with extremely high flow, designed for levelling floors and creating a final floor finish imitating cured concrete, mainly in residential spaces, in various colour finishes.

A dry mix of special cements, dried sands up to 0.5 mm, and fillers up to 0.09 mm. Applied at a thickness of 1.5 mm to 10 mm, locally also up to 20 mm; the optimal average thickness is approximately 5 mm. Low viscosity ensures very easy workability.

At least seven colour shades, with custom tinting available. After mixing with water and application, colours partially fade to the shades shown in the sample chart; the surface gradually lightens slightly during curing. After partial curing (2–5 days), we recommend sanding the surface and impregnating it with a suitable polymer.

Compressive strength (28 d)

≥ 44 MPa

Flexural strength

10 MPa

Layer thickness

1.5–20 mm

Group: Self-levelling and auxiliary compounds, screeds

A powder universal high-strength, fast-setting and fast-hardening self-levelling compound with extremely high flow and low consumption. Designed for levelling floors and creating a final floor finish imitating cured concrete, mainly in residential spaces.

A dry mix of special cements and dried fillers up to 0.5 mm. Applied at a thickness of 0.5 mm to 10 mm, locally also up to 20 mm; the optimal average thickness is approximately 5 mm. The hardened compound has a very smooth surface; in some cases, sanding isn't necessary.

After partial curing (2–5 days), we recommend sanding the surface, vacuuming it, and impregnating it with a suitable polymer, such as a matte or gloss polyurethane.

Compressive strength (28 d)

≥ 40 MPa

Flexural strength

7.5 MPa

Layer thickness

0.5–20 mm

Group: Self-levelling and auxiliary compounds, screeds

A powder universal high-strength, fast-setting and fast-hardening self-levelling compound with extremely high flow, designed for levelling floors and creating a final floor finish imitating cured concrete in various colour finishes.

A dry mix of special cements and dried fillers up to 0.09 mm. Applied at a thickness of 0.5 mm to 10 mm, locally also up to 20 mm. The surface is very smooth, in some cases without any need for sanding.

At least seven colour shades, with custom tinting available to customer specifications. After mixing with water and application, colours partially fade to the shades shown in the sample chart.

Compressive strength (28 d)

≥ 45 MPa

Flexural strength

10 MPa

Layer thickness

0.5–20 mm

03

Primers

Primer coatings and bonding bridges designed to even out substrate absorbency, increase adhesion, and improve the functionality of subsequent layers in building systems.

3 products · Substrate preparation

Group: Primers, impregnations

A polymer water dispersion used to impregnate concrete products, and in particular as a priming bonding bridge when laying a fresh concrete layer, the self-levelling compounds NIVOFIN B and P, NOVOLIT B and EXTRAFIN B, the BETOFIN B/BR and REPAFIN 5 skim coats, renders, and similar.

It also serves as a curing, hardening, and sealing treatment for the wearing layer of a concrete floor; it creates a durable, highly resistant, dust-free surface on existing (cured) or freshly laid floors, and increases resistance to abrasion and water penetration.

Main uses: concrete roads and car parks, concrete courtyard surfaces, warehouses, monolithic concrete structures, precast concrete elements. Use within 7 days of dilution.

Diluted with water according to the bonding bridge's function

1 : 4Concrete on concrete, repair mortar on concrete (must soak in); levelling compounds (must dry)
1 : 9Under renders and skim coats (must dry)
1 : 15Under renders and skim coats, vapour permeability (must dry)

Consumption

0.1–0.5 l/m²

Packaging

5 and 10 l

Shelf life

12 months

Group: Primers, impregnations

A polymer water dispersion with particle sizes in the nanometre range. Used mainly to impregnate concrete products, or as a priming bonding bridge when laying a fresh concrete layer, the self-levelling compounds NIVOFIN B and P, NOVOLIT B and EXTRAFIN B, the BETOFIN B/BR and REPAFIN 5 skim coats, especially when the substrate isn't sufficiently firm, since it penetrates deeper than standard primers.

It can be combined with PENESAN K once both have been diluted to application concentration.

Creates a durable, highly resistant, dust-free surface on cured concrete floors; increases resistance to abrasion and water penetration.

Dilution

1 : 4

Particles

nano

Appearance

faintly milky, translucent

Group: Primers, impregnations

A polymer water dispersion with added admixtures and sand up to 0.5 mm. Used as a bonding bridge when laying a fresh concrete layer, the self-levelling compounds NIVOFIN B and P, NOVOLIT B and EXTRAFIN B, the BETOFIN B/BR and REPAFIN 5 skim coats, whenever there's no certainty that the required bond strength to the substrate will be achieved after application.

Once applied to the substrate, it increases the substrate's water-tightness. Not diluted; active content is 80%.

After adding approximately 300 g of cement per litre, adjusting with water, and applying to concrete at a thickness of 3 mm or more, it creates a waterproofing layer.

Consumption

~ 1 l/m²

Active content

80%

Shelf life

3 months

04

Polymer gypsum

A special polymer-modified gypsum compound designed for restoration work, producing decorative elements, repairing historic structures, and creating precise castings.

1 product · Restoration materials

Group: Casting compounds and fillers for restorers, cement mixes

A powder one-component polymer gypsum composite casting compound for interior and exterior use, designed for casting artistic and decorative craft objects.

The dry mix, based on gypsum and an organic polymer, is mixed with water in a ratio of 5 kg of mix to 1.25 kg of cold water. Once thoroughly mixed, it reaches a high degree of fluidity and relatively low viscosity, ideal for filling moulds and cavities. It's characterised by a high-quality cast impression.

After rapid curing, the result is a high-strength, frost-resistant, low-absorption compound with low abrasion, also suitable for exterior use. Open time can be regulated with a retarder; micro-reinforcing alkali-resistant glass fibres (~10%) are available, along with the option of adjusting with dried sands up to a 1:1 ratio. The compound is non-toxic.

Compressive strength

~ 40 MPa

Flexural strength

~ 9 MPa

Mixing ratio

5 kg + 1.25 kg water
